Data From: ChatGPT versus expert feedback on clinical reasoning questions and their effect on learning: a randomized controlled trial

Authors: Çiçek, Feray Ekin; Ülker, Müşerref; Özer, Menekşe; Kıyak, Yavuz Selim;

Data From: ChatGPT versus expert feedback on clinical reasoning questions and their effect on learning: a randomized controlled trial

Abstract

Dataset Info 1) Immediate Test- The first row of the dataset identifies the columns.- Column A represents the participants’ iDs.- Column B represents the participants’ assigned group [0: Control (ExpertFeedback) 1: Intervention (ChatGPTFeedback)].- Column C represents the genders of the participants (1: Female, 2: Male).- Column D represents the first-year repetition status of the participants. (0: No, 1: Yes)- Column E to H represent the scores in four different uncomplicated urinary tract infection (UTI)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column I represents the total scores in uncomplic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items. - Column J to M represent the scores in four different complic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column N represents the total scores in complic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items. - Column O to R represent the scores in four different pyelonephritis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column S represents the total scores in pyelonephritis Key-Features Questions Items. - Column T represents the total scores in immediate test. 2) Delayed Test- The first row of the dataset identifies the columns.- Column A represents the participants iDs.- Column B represents the participants’ assigned group [0: Control (ExpertFeedback) 1: Intervention (ChatGPTFeedback)].- Column C represents the genders of the participants (1: Female, 2: Male).- Column D represents the first-year repetition status of the participants. (0: No, 1: Yes)- Column E to H represent the scores in four different uncomplicated urinary tract infection (UTI)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column I represents the total scores in uncomplic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items. - Column J to M represent the scores in four different complic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column N represents the total scores in complicated UTI Key-Features Questions Items. - Column O to R represent the scores in four different pyelonephritis Key-Features Questions Items separately. - Column S represents the total scores in pyelonephritis Key-Features Questions Items. - Column T represents the total scores in delayed test. 3) Pre-Intervention Survey on Critical Approach to AI- The first row of the dataset identifies the columns.- Column A represents the participants iDs.- Column B represents the participants’ assigned group [0: Control (ExpertFeedback) 1: Intervention (ChatGPTFeedback)].- Column C represents the genders of the participants (1: Female, 2: Male).- Column D represents the first-year repetition status of the participants (0: No, 1: Yes).- Column E to J represent the responses of the participants to survey questions before the intervention. Each column is evaluated on a scale from 1 to 7. As it progresses from 1 to 7, the agreement status of participants to survey questions increases. (1: No agreement at all, 7: completely agree) 4) Post-Intervention Survey on Critical Approach to AI- The first row of the dataset identifies the columns.- Column A represents the participants iDs.- Column B represents the participants’ assigned group [0: Control (ExpertFeedback) 1: Intervention (ChatGPTFeedback)].- Column C represents the genders of the participants (1: Female, 2: Male).- Column D represents the first-year repetition status of the participants (0: No, 1: Yes).- Column E to J represent the evaluation of the participants to survey questions after intervention. Each column is evaluated on a scale from 1 to 7. As it progresses from 1 to 7, the agreement status of participants to survey questions increases. (1: No agreement at all, 7: completely agree)
